I use Protel99 SE SP6and have installed the Agfa AccuSet 1000 PostScript
printer.

I print all my designd to .ps files and convert them to .pdf.

Ti the people at the print sjop, I always put a note in the e-mail to
produce film "AS IS" (because the bottom layer is already flipped), and
if I make DS boards, I 'print' Top layer mirrored.

BTW my friends in the print shop are already "trained" not to flip the
files that I send them, or they will produce another set on their expence :)
